    I am a Bedouin, and I've spent my whole life in Petra, Jordan. Now I'm trying to share my home and culture with people from around the world by opening a B&B for tourists coming to experience this Wonder of the World. I'm looking for help with running the place, in exchange for room and board, plus the opportunity to live within walking distance of incredible two-thousand-year-old monuments, learn Arabic, and soak up traditional Bedouin culture.

    Help

    I recently opened a new B&B for tourists to Petra, and need help maintaining the facilities. This will involve cleaning the house, but will also entail cooking traditional Bedouin meals with me when tourists request. I may also request your help in marketing and publicizing the property when opportunities arise.

    What else ...

    Aside from Jordan's most famous tourist attraction being only 10 minutes away, Jordan is full of cultural attractions like concerts in Amman, natural splendors like Wadi Rum and Dana Nature Reserve, and plenty of hiking and rock climbing opportunities. Volunteers will have ample time to explore the country.
